November 9, 2004

Colquitt County-- Investigators are looking for clues after the deaths of four people. They're also looking for a missing 3-year-old boy.

When four children returned home from school Monday afternoon, they made a horrible discovery. They found the bodies of four adults inside a Colquitt County home. They did not find a 3-year-old boy, Juan Rucindez, who was there when they left for school this morning.

Several Law enforcement agencies are cooperating in the investigation, including the GBI, Colquitt County authorities, and the Thomasville Crime Unit. It's not known whether little Juan wandered off, or if he was abducted. Authorities are interviewing one of the sisters of one of the victims at the sheriff's department. They have not release positive identifications of the dead as of yet.

The four children who discovered the horrific scene have been assisted by DFACS, and are with family members now. The GBI indicated that a sister of one of the victims came onto the scene, and said that she knew, or might know, what happened, but no further information on that has been given.
